Challenge

Cleaning perforated metal isn’t a flat-surface problem. The customer needed a solution capable of thoroughly cleaning a wide variety of perforated materials, from narrow strips to large sheets up to 60 inches wide, all while maintaining consistent quality at a production speed of 18 feet per minute. The complexity of the perforations created countless small openings where debris, oils, and contaminants could hide, making uniform cleaning difficult. At the same time, the system had to safely handle both roll-fed and individual parts without compromising throughput or process control.

Approach

Better Engineering engineered a custom Cyberjet C-60 stainless steel conveyor washer designed to tackle the unique challenges of perforated materials. The system was built to accommodate a wide range of part sizes and configurations, ensuring flexibility across different product types.

To maintain consistent cleaning performance, the washer integrates controlled part handling with hold-down mechanisms that stabilize materials as they move through the system. An electronic eye monitors part flow, helping synchronize operation and maintain process accuracy. Safety features such as locking door switches provide secure operation while allowing for efficient, continuous processing.

The conveyorized design supports steady throughput, ensuring that even at higher production speeds, all surfaces including internal perforations receive proper exposure to the cleaning process.

Results

The Cyberjet C-60 delivered a versatile and reliable cleaning solution capable of handling perforated materials across a broad size range. Its ability to process parts from as narrow as a few inches up to 60 inches wide allowed the customer to standardize cleaning across multiple product lines.

Enhanced process control features improved consistency and repeatability, while integrated safety mechanisms ensured secure operation. The result was a stable, high-throughput cleaning process that maintained quality while reducing variability across different part types.
